Output 6e420ed9f8d456e50ec54312fc7683465427659c5cae875b7dec5c9e40bdc097:104

value
67164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aebbca9027f35c5f1113a9bbd677722bd00035f OP_EQUAL
address
38XAL2gsG4UdtZusGb8Lg9jEwRWi2r6k7F
transaction
6e420ed9f8d456e50ec54312fc7683465427659c5cae875b7dec5c9e40bdc097
confirmations
249305
spent
true